I'm writing from Peru, Tracey. I work for the government pension fund and use ACL for checking a myriad of conditions interesting from the Internal Audit group viewpoint, especially those data that are critical for deciding the amount of the pensions to be paid. Curiously enough, despite that the US is far ahead of Peru when it comes to technological resources, we also are among the very few (not more than ten) government entities that apply software tools for their IA groups.

Before being here, I've used ACL at banks, insurance companies, private pension funds, etc. and did equally well. However, I'm now using IDEA on a test basis and have found that the latter's Windows-based capabilities far exceed those of ACL.

    I am curious  - how many of you use ACL actively?

    We have used it for an increasing number of applications, but I feel as if we are in the forefront on the government scene with it's use.  We have used it for payroll testing, vouchers, financial transactions, insurance, student financial aid, and contracts compliance (at least I think that's it).  What other applications have you used it for?
